Who will you be working with?

You will be a key player in directing daily production operations at our small, but growing, overhaul/repair facility located in San Fernando, CA. You will be working together with both hourly and salary personnel while building relationships with the materials, quality, engineering, and production team.

How You Will Make a Difference?

As a production supervisor, you will support the daily operations of the area to ensure reliability and consistency on the production floor. The Supervisor is responsible for safely leading a team to assemble products to Wabtec’s quality standards. The Supervisor is also responsible for ensuring that his/her team is working safely, efficiently, and effectively, providing high-quality products and customer service to our customers and Wabtec’s stakeholders. This position requires working onsite to support production.

What We Want to Know About You?

We are looking for someone who understands functional, business, and company-wide objectives. You will be expected to directly drive critical KPIs in safety, quality, and delivery of repair and overhaul services across multiple product lines, ensuring we meet our ambitious goals.

Experience and Qualifications:

  • High School graduate, or general education degree required. Bachelor’s Degree preferred.

  • Three years minimum of experience as a manufacturing supervisor required.

  • Prior leadership experience in both union and non-union facilities.

  • In-depth knowledge of EHS, shop operations, customer service operations, manufacturing engineering, quality, materials, sourcing, and material logistics in a heavy manufacturing environment.

  • Proven ability to utilize lean, 5S, and continuous improvement methodologies.

  • Adaptability and flexibility in a dynamic environment.

  • Demonstrated ability to drive accountability, improve culture, and influence teams.

  • Strong coaching and team engagement skills.

  • Solid understanding of operations and business financials, including shop functions, variance, and inventory management.

  • Excellent oral and written communication skills.

  • Strong interpersonal and leadership abilities.

What Will Your Typical Day Look Like?

  • Drive Operational Excellence: Utilize lean and continuous improvement methods to enhance safety, reliability, quality, cost efficiency, and variance.

  • Leadership and Development: Lead and develop your team, ensuring that they are motivated, engaged, and aligned with the company’s goals and values.

  • Strategic Planning: Develop and implement strategies to optimize production, improve processes, and achieve long-term business objectives.

  • Collaboration: Work closely with other departments such as production scheduling, engineering, purchasing, and quality to ensure seamless operations and optimized production strategies.

  • Lean Transformation: Lead the Lean Transformation initiatives across the site including production layout changes.

  • Compliance and Safety: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ations, company policies, and safety standards to maintain a safe and efficient work environment.

  • Continuous Improvement: Foster a culture of continuous improvement by encouraging innovation, listening to employee ideas, and implementing effective solutions.

Physical Demands of the Job:

  • Hands-On Involvement: Regular exposure to the shop floor, requiring the use of PPE.

  • Active Engagement: Walking, climbing, stooping, bending, and lifting as part of the hands-on learning and engagement process.

Our job titles may span more than one career level. The salary range for this role is between

$60,700.00-$83,400.00

The actual salary offered to a candidate may be influenced by a variety of factors, such as: training, transferable skills, work experience, education, business needs, market demands and work location. The base pay range is subject to change and may be modified in the future. More information on offered benefits, which include health, welfare, and retirement, are available at mywabtecbenefits.com . Other benefit offerings for this role may include an annual bonus, if eligible.
